Download Dsls In Action ebook PDF or Read Online books in PDF, EPUB, and Mobi Format. Click Download or Read Online button to Dsls In Action book pdf for free now.

Dsls In Action

Author : Debasish Ghosh
ISBN : 9350040352
Genre :
File Size : 36.54 MB
Format : PDF, ePub
Download : 717
Read : 1023

Market_Desc: This book is written for developers working with JVM languages. Others will find techniques that (generally) work for them too. Special Features: Learning Elements in this book:· Tested, real-world examples· How to find the right level of abstraction· Using language features to build internal DSLs· Designing parser/combinator-based little languages About The Book: DSLs in Action introduce the concepts you'll need to build high-quality domain-specific languages. It explores DSL implementation based on JVM languages like Java, Scala, Clojure, Ruby, and Groovy and contains fully explained code snippets that implement real-world DSL designs. For experienced developers, the book addresses the intricacies of DSL design without the pain of writing parsers by hand.This book is written for developers working with JVM languages. Others will find techniques that (generally) work for them too.

Software Design And Development Concepts Methodologies Tools And Applications

Author : Management Association, Information Resources
ISBN : 9781466643024
Genre : Computers
File Size : 60.44 MB
Format : PDF, Mobi
Download : 454
Read : 1076

Innovative tools and techniques for the development and design of software systems are essential to the problem solving and planning of software solutions. Software Design and Development: Concepts, Methodologies, Tools, and Applications brings together the best practices of theory and implementation in the development of software systems. This reference source is essential for researchers, engineers, practitioners, and scholars seeking the latest knowledge on the techniques, applications, and methodologies for the design and development of software systems.
Category: Computers

Formal And Practical Aspects Of Domain Specific Languages Recent Developments

Author : Mernik, Marjan
ISBN : 9781466620933
Genre : Computers
File Size : 79.49 MB
Format : PDF, ePub, Mobi
Download : 896
Read : 533

"This book presents current research on all aspects of domain-specific language for scholars and practitioners in the software engineering fields, providing new results and answers to open problems in DSL research"--
Category: Computers

Functional And Reactive Domain Modeling

Author : Debasish Ghosh
ISBN : 1617292249
Genre : Computers
File Size : 89.81 MB
Format : PDF, Docs
Download : 949
Read : 977

Functional and Reactive Domain Modeling teaches readers how to think of the domain model in terms of pure functions and how to compose them to build larger abstractions. It begins with the basics of functional programming and gradually progresses to the advanced concepts and patterns needed to implement complex domain models. The book demonstrates how advanced FP patterns like algebraic data types, typeclass based design, and isolation of side-effects can make models compose for readability and verifiability. On the subject of reactive modeling, the book focuses on higher order concurrency patterns like actors and futures. It uses the Akka framework as the reference implementation and demonstrates how advanced architectural patterns like event sourcing and CQRS can be put to great use in implementing scalable models. It offers techniques that are radically different from the standard RDBMS based applications that are based on mutation of records. It also shares important patterns like using asynchronous messaging for interaction based on non blocking concurrency and model persistence, which delivers the speed of in- memory processing along with suitable guarantees of reliability.
Category: Computers

Domain Specific Development With Visual Studio Dsl Tools

Author : Steve Cook
ISBN : 0132701553
Genre : Computers
File Size : 61.5 MB
Format : PDF
Download : 952
Read : 317

Domain-Specific Languages (DSLs)--languages geared to specific vertical or horizontal areas of interest--are generating growing excitement from software engineers and architects. DSLs bring new agility to the creation and evolution of software, allowing selected design aspects to be expressed in terms much closer to the system requirements than standard program code, significantly reducing development costs in large-scale projects and product lines. In this breakthrough book, four leading experts reveal exactly how DSLs work, and how you can make the most of them in your environment. With Domain-Specific Development with Visual Studio DSL Tools , you'll begin by mastering DSL concepts and techniques that apply to all platforms. Next, you'll discover how to create and use DSLs with the powerful new Microsoft DSL Tools--a toolset designed by this book's authors. Learn how the DSL Tools integrate into Visual Studio--and how to define DSLs and generate Visual Designers using Visual Studio's built-in modeling technology. In-depth coverage includes Determining whether DSLs will work for you Comparing DSLs with other approaches to model-driven development Defining, tuning, and evolving DSLs: models, presentation, creation, updates, serialization, constraints, validation, and more Creating Visual Designers for new DSLs with little or no coding Multiplying productivity by generating application code from your models with easy-to-use text templates Automatically generating configuration files, resources, and other artifacts Deploying Visual Designers across the organization, quickly and easily Customizing Visual Designers for specialized process needs List of Figures List of Tables Foreword Preface About the Authors Chapter 1 Domain-Specific Development Chapter 2 Creating and Using DSLs Chapter 3 Domain Model Definition Chapter 4 Presentation Chapter 5 Creation, Deletion, and Update Behavior Chapter 6 Serialization Chapter 7 Constraints and Validation Chapter 8 Generating Artifacts Chapter 9 Deploying a DSL Chapter 10 Advanced DSL Customization Chapter 11 Designing a DSL Index
Category: Computers

The Global Information Technology Report 2002 2003

Author : Soumitra Dutta
ISBN : 0195161696
Genre : Technology & Engineering
File Size : 73.89 MB
Format : PDF, ePub
Download : 136
Read : 153

Comprehensive assessment of networked readiness, covering eighty-two of the leading economies of the world.
Category: Technology & Engineering

Dsl Advances

Author : Thomas Starr
ISBN : 0130938106
Genre : Computers
File Size : 59.92 MB
Format : PDF, ePub, Docs
Download : 552
Read : 902

Comprehensive coverage of physical-layer and upper-layer aspects are a unique feature of this book. It covers the latest in both U.S. and international standards. Experts who helped to write the DSL standards describe the many advances in DSL technology and applications since the writing of their bestselling "Understanding Digital Subscriber Line Technology."
Category: Computers

Free Will And Luck

Author : Alfred R. Mele
ISBN : 9780195374391
Genre : Philosophy
File Size : 54.68 MB
Format : PDF, Docs
Download : 958
Read : 972

Mele's ultimate purpose in this book is to help readers think more clearly about free will. He identifies and makes vivid the most important conceptual obstacles to justified belief in the existence of free will and meets them head on. Mele clarifies the central issue in the philosophical debate about free will and moral responsibility, criticizes various influential contemporary theories about free will, and develops two overlapping conceptions of free will - one for readers who are convinced that free will is incompatible with determinism (incompatibilists), and the other for readers who are convinced of the opposite (compatibilists). Mele's theory offers an original perspective on an important problem and will garner the attention of anyone interested in the debate on free will.
Category: Philosophy